The empire has crumbled.

Now, what to do of the ruins?

The new kings will circle and pick off the best of the remnants.

Wayne Rooney to Chelsea. Nemanja Vidic to one of the Milans. Rio Ferdinand to Twitter. Robin Van Persie… well, for United fans this could get a whole lot worse before it gets any better.

The Premier League is unforgiving and relentless in its destruction of great teams – Blackburn Rovers, Leeds, Forest… Granted the tradition, backing and pedigree and United makes a one season slump look like the absolute maximum.

The question now at Old Trafford is not who will come in, but how many of their world-class stars will go.

David Moyes has steered his team into the perfect storm. Nobody better than Jose Mourinho at Chelsea to profit from it.

Rooney and Vidic both have begun to see press headlines swirl with their names on transfer lists, with contract extensions not being renewed.

Moyes may well have to build from ground zero. Because that is what his team will be reduced to at this rate.

While the UK press linked Rooney with Chelsea and multi-million pound transfer deal, Vidic’s agent has refused to commit to a contract extension at Old Trafford.
